Character-Encoding

Duplicity和GPG:字元集轉換

  • January 11, 2014

我在 OS X Mavericks 上使用雙重性。

如果我執行我的 duplicity 命令,我會收到以下錯誤:

===== Begin GnuPG log =====
gpg: conversion from `US-ASCII' to `utf-8' failed: Illegal byte sequence
gpg: “0DB243EE”: skipped: public key not found
gpg: [stdin]: encryption failed: public key not found
===== End GnuPG log =====

奇怪的是,備份命令直到最近才起作用。

我怎樣才能解決這個問題?

我找到了解決方案。我總是使用 –encrypt-key=“XXXXXXXX” 選項執行 duplicity。但由於某種原因,我必須在沒有“=”和引號的情況下執行它。正確的語法是:–encrypt-key XXXXXXXXX。

引用自:https://unix.stackexchange.com/questions/108808